  | 
				VFP 愛用者社區 本討論區為 Visual Foxpro 愛用者經驗交流的地方, 請多多利用"搜尋"的功能, 先查看看有無前例可循, 如果還有不懂的再發問. 部份主題有附加檔案, 須先註冊成為社區居民才可以下載.   
				 | 
			 
		 
		 
	
		| 上一篇主題 :: 下一篇主題   | 
	 
	
	
		| 發表人 | 
		內容 | 
	 
	
		raylian
 
  
  註冊時間: 2006-08-09 文章: 25
 
  第 1 樓
  | 
		
			
				 發表於: 星期五 十月 20, 2006 9:28 am    文章主題: 請教SQL SERVER空值問題 | 
				     | 
			 
			
				
  | 
			 
			
				| 我使用VFP9做前端,SQL SERVER 2005做后端, 如何能去掉SQL SERVER中欄位中的空值(.NULL.),因為有的欄位是允許空,這樣的話在VFP前端就顯示很多NULL值,顯示NULL值就會產生很多錯誤,(我使用的是遠程視圖,邦定控件). | 
			 
		  | 
	 
	
		| 回頂端 | 
		 | 
	 
	
		  | 
	 
	
		BIN
 
  
  註冊時間: 2004-07-22 文章: 94 來自: Tainan, Taiwan
  第 2 樓
  | 
		
			
				 發表於: 星期五 十月 20, 2006 9:51 am    文章主題:  | 
				     | 
			 
			
				
  | 
			 
			
				SQL SERVER的SELECT語法中有提供一個ISNULL()函數,
 
功能跟FOXPRO的NVL()一樣,
 
看是不是就是您要的...
 
 
用法:
 
ISNULL(VAL1,VAL2)
 
 
VAL1為要判斷是否為NULL的變數
 
VAL2當VAL1為NULL時,所要替代的值 | 
			 
		  | 
	 
	
		| 回頂端 | 
		 | 
	 
	
		  | 
	 
	
		xdpxzhz
 
 
  註冊時間: 2006-02-11 文章: 24
 
  第 3 樓
  | 
		
			
				 發表於: 星期五 十月 20, 2006 1:14 pm    文章主題: SET NULL OFF | 
				     | 
			 
			
				
  | 
			 
			
				| SET NULL OFF | 
			 
		  | 
	 
	
		| 回頂端 | 
		 | 
	 
	
		  | 
	 
	
		thornbird313
 
 
  註冊時間: 2004-12-14 文章: 23
 
  第 4 樓
  | 
		
			
				 發表於: 星期三 十一月 22, 2006 4:25 am    文章主題:  | 
				     | 
			 
			
				
  | 
			 
			
				| SET NULLDISPLAY TO "" | 
			 
		  | 
	 
	
		| 回頂端 | 
		 | 
	 
	
		  | 
	 
	
		 | 
	 
 
  
  	 
	    
  	   | 
 	
您 無法 在這個版面發表文章 您 無法 在這個版面回覆文章 您 無法 在這個版面編輯文章 您 無法 在這個版面刪除文章 您 無法 在這個版面進行投票 您 無法 在這個版面附加檔案 您 無法 在這個版面下載檔案
  | 
   
  
		 |